The Tampa Bay Rays’ Journey Through Hurricane Milton and Beyond

Even before Hurricane Milton shook Tropicana Field to its core, the Tampa Bay Rays were already facing a tough road ahead in 2025. Coming off a disappointing season, the end of a playoff streak, and significant roster changes, the Rays were in for a challenging year.

With their domed stadium out of commission, the Rays found themselves relocating to Tampa’s Steinbrenner Field, facing new challenges of heat, rain, and playing in an open-air ballpark shared with the Yankees. The loss of their ace pitcher, Shane McClanahan, added to their woes.

The Rays Embrace Challenges and Seize Opportunities

Despite the odds stacked against them, the Rays are determined to defy expectations. With a revamped roster and a new home at Steinbrenner Field, the team is ready to make a statement this season.

Manager Kevin Cash believes that the unique conditions at Steinbrenner Field could work in their favor, providing a boost to their offensive capabilities. The camaraderie and energy of the crowd are expected to drive the team forward.
